保护口令的最好方式也许是制造假口令

简介: 本文讲的是 保护口令的最好方式也许是制造假口令,如果需要向大量网站提供随机、独立的密码,密码管理软件是个不错的选择。但这种方法的致命弱点在于,只需要一个主密码就可以开启整个密码库。

image

本文讲的是 保护口令的最好方式也许是制造假口令,如果需要向大量网站提供随机、独立的密码,密码管理软件是个不错的选择。但这种方法的致命弱点在于,只需要一个主密码就可以开启整个密码库。

然而,一组研究人员已经开发出了一种密码管理软件,如果用户输入了错误的主密码,它会显示一个诱饵密码库。

这一软件名为NoCrack,其设计目的是让黑客发现自己攻击失败时更加困难、耗费更多的时间。

作为攻击者,你不知道哪个密码库才是真的。攻击者没有其它选择,只有在网站上对密码进行试错。”

密码管理软件的一大问题是,这类软件会把所有密码存在一个加密文件里。如果攻击者从受害者的电脑上偷走这个文件,就可以使用它进行暴力破解攻击。在暴力破解攻击中,攻击者会连续尝试成千上百的密码。

如果键入了错误的密码,攻击者很容易发现它是错的。生成的文件是垃圾,因此攻击者不会通过在线网站服务对密码进行试错。对每一次错误的尝试,NoCrack都会生成一份看上去合理的密码库,诱饵的上限是无穷无尽的。确认这些登录信息是否正确的唯一方式就是在网站上一个一个地试。

这种方法“昂贵且缓慢”。

由于大多数在线服务都会限制猜测密码的次数,攻击者不会得到很多发现真相的机会。

NoCrack并不是第一个在此领域作出尝试的软件。另一个被称为Kamouflage的软件与其类似。不过,NoCrack的设计者表示Kamouflage在生成主密钥诱饵方面存在缺陷。

Kamouflage的诱饵主密钥是基于真实版本生成的。通过研究诱饵主密钥,攻击者可以了解到真实的主密钥的结构,进而发现它们。NoCrack团队在这方面做得更好。

NoCrack使用了自然语言编码(NLE)算法,具有讽刺意味的是,该方法也被用在密码破解应用上。根据论文中的描述,NLE算法会对比特串进行编码,得出自然语言中的文本,即使输入相同,每次得到的输出也会不同。

研究者发现,如果攻击者使用基于简单机器学习的工具,试图从诱饵密钥中猜出真实密钥,NLE会阻止这种类型的攻击。

不过还有一个巨大的问题:如果用户错拼了密码怎么办?在这种情景下,软件也会生成一份诱饵密钥库,用户没办法访问自己的账户。

NoCrack团队表示正在研究解决方案。一个可行的策略是:创建主密钥的哈希值,并将其链接到一张输入密码时会显示的图片上。合法用户在碰到错误图片时会意识到问题,攻击者则不会。另一个策略是,如果密码只是稍微偏离正确版本,就对它进行自动矫正。

NoCrack还没有商业化计划。

原文发布时间为:五月 29, 2015
本文作者:Venvoo
本文来自云栖社区合作伙伴安全牛,了解相关信息可以关注安全牛。
原文链接:http://www.aqniu.com/industry/7867.html

相关文章
|
6月前
|
数据安全/隐私保护
超级弱口令检查工具
超级弱口令工具在检测系统漏洞中的作用,包括如何使用和自定义设置。
909 2
|
7月前
|
SQL 安全 应用服务中间件
技术心得记录:弱口令漏洞详解
技术心得记录:弱口令漏洞详解
|
8月前
|
安全 BI 数据安全/隐私保护
每天一道C语言编程:合格密码的判定
每天一道C语言编程:合格密码的判定
59 0
|
SQL 存储 开发框架
MSSQL弱口令绕过某数字上线
MSSQL弱口令绕过某数字上线
205 0
|
安全 前端开发 JavaScript
代码审计——硬编码口令/弱口令详解
代码审计——硬编码口令/弱口令详解
507 0
|
安全 数据安全/隐私保护
弱密码检测又没过?教你一键设置高强度随机密码
有时候为了简单,总喜欢设置123456的弱密码,但是这种密码过于简单,不太安全。
181 0
|
应用服务中间件 数据库 数据安全/隐私保护
拼搏百天我要日站——常见弱口令
弱口令(weak password) 没有严格和准确的定义,通常认为容易被别人猜测到或被破解工具破解的口令均为弱口令。弱口令指的是仅包含简单数字和字母的口令,例如“123”、“abc”等,因为这样的口令很容易被别人破解,从而使用户的互联网账号受到他人控制,因此不推荐用户使用
307 0
拼搏百天我要日站——常见弱口令
|
存储 安全 数据安全/隐私保护
4位密码、明文存储、还不让用户修改,但这家美国百年企业说自己很安全
本文讲的是4位密码、明文存储、还不让用户修改,但这家美国百年企业说自己很安全,一般来说,像银行、金融服务或者其它类型的网站采用了有问题的密码策略,比如只允许6-8位密码、大写字母密码小写也可以登录、电子邮件回复明文密码等,这样的网站我们大多不会去讲,因为实在说不过来,而且也有@PWTooStrong 这样专门讲账号安全策略的推特。
1384 0
|
安全 数据安全/隐私保护
价值10000美元的Uber漏洞,可随意重置任何账户的密码
本文讲的是价值10000美元的Uber漏洞,可随意重置任何账户的密码,近日,一名意大利安全专家在Uber系统中发现了一个关键的身份验证不当漏洞,利用该漏洞,攻击者可以对任何账户重新设置密码。
1512 0